Сообщение об ошибке «невозможно найти пакет npm» обычно появляется, когда менеджер пакетов (например, apt или apt-get) не может найти и установить пакет npm. Вот несколько способов решения этой проблемы:
-
Обновить списки пакетов: выполните следующую команду, чтобы обновить списки пакетов в вашей системе:
sudo apt update -
Установите Node.js: npm обычно устанавливается вместе с Node.js. Убедитесь, что Node.js установлен в вашей системе, выполнив следующую команду:
sudo apt install nodejs -
Установите npm напрямую. Если Node.js уже установлен, вы можете попробовать установить npm напрямую с помощью следующей команды:
sudo apt install npm -
Использовать диспетчер версий Node (NVM). NVM позволяет управлять несколькими версиями Node.js и npm. Установите NVM, следуя инструкциям в официальном репозитории GitHub: https://github.com/nvm-sh/nvm
-
Установка вручную. Если описанные выше методы не работают, попробуйте установить npm вручную. Сначала загрузите скрипт установки npm:
curl -L https://www.npmjs.com/install.sh | sudo sh -
Используйте другой менеджер пакетов. Вместо apt вы можете попробовать использовать другой менеджер пакетов, например Yarn. Установите пряжу с помощью следующей команды:
sudo apt install yarn